Why Live in Hillman

Hillman is a small residential neighborhood in Birmingham situated between West Brownville and Grasselli Heights. This area is known for its quiet, secluded atmosphere, set apart from the busier parts of the city. While this seclusion offers privacy, it also means fewer nearby amenities. The neighborhood features a mix of well-maintained homes and streets, although some properties require revitalization. Housing primarily consists of 1950s and 1960s ranch-style homes and bungalows, with prices ranging from around $30,000 for fixer-uppers to $90,000 for renovated properties. The area lacks sidewalks, reducing walkability. West Brownville Park, a 2-acre green space, features playgrounds, a walking trail, and a basketball court. Grasselli Heights Park includes a fenced playground and a picnic pavilion. Red Mountain Park, located 4 miles east, features 16 miles of trails, scenic overlooks, and a popular dog park. Interstate 20 and Route 11 provide convenient access to downtown Birmingham, and public transit is available half a mile west on Jefferson Avenue. Dining options include EZ Street Wings and familiar chains like Wendy’s and Waffle House within 2 miles. The annual Magic City Classic football game and the Sidewalk Film Festival are notable local events.

Is Hillman a good place to live?
Hillman is a good place to live. Hillman is considered very car-dependent and bikeable with some transit options. Hillman is a suburban neighborhood. Hillman has 8 parks for recreational activities. It is fairly sparse in population with 5.0 people per acre and a median age of 47. The average household income is $42,213 which is below the national average. College graduates make up 19.1% of residents. A majority of residents in Hillman are home owners, with 33% of residents renting and 67% of residents owning their home. Is Hillman, AL a safe neighborhood?
Hillman, AL is less safe than the average neighborhood in the United States. It received a crime score of 5 out of 10.
How much do you need to make to afford a house in Hillman?
The median home price in Hillman is $87,400. If you put a 20% down payment of $17,500 and had a 30-year fixed mortgage with an interest rate of 6.47%, your estimated principal and interest payment would be $440 a month plus property taxes, HOA fees, home insurance, PMI, and utilities. Using the 28% rule, you would need to make at least $19K a year to afford the median home price in Hillman. Learn how much home you can afford with our Home Affordability Calculator. The average household income in Hillman is $42K.
